Output e14c5c24cb6086a751a5bd8144d1f25c1942e8f0ab77e82fda1f9c3160692dca:0

value
11029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e131815a97e92990c3d230af7a914fee4c1f0dc OP_EQUAL
address
3Bj38KooVEr5rq7GwuM7GHq62bKqHpnNbD
transaction
e14c5c24cb6086a751a5bd8144d1f25c1942e8f0ab77e82fda1f9c3160692dca
confirmations
23111
spent
true